Type 1 Diabetes is a chronic condition in which the pancreas produces little or no insulin, resulting in high blood sugar levels. Managing this condition requires regular medical care, including visits to endocrinologists, diabetes educators, and other specialists. Access to quality healthcare is crucial for individuals with Type 1 Diabetes to ensure they can lead healthy and fulfilling lives.
